The Artistic Legacy of Donald Judd
Born in 1928, Donald Judd emerged in the 1960s as a leading voice against Abstract Expressionism's emotional gesturalism. He advocated for art that was straightforward, non-hierarchical, and focused on the physical properties of materials. Judd's philosophy, detailed in his seminal essay "Specific Objects" (1965), argued that art should avoid metaphorical content and instead engage directly with form, color, and space. His prints, produced primarily in the 1970s and 1980s, extend this ideology onto paper, using techniques like screenprinting and lithography to create geometric compositions that emphasize flatness and repetition.
Characteristics of Donald Judd Prints
Judd's prints are not mere reproductions of his sculptures but independent explorations of two-dimensional space. They often feature bold, rectangular forms arranged in grids or serial patterns, with colors derived from industrial paints rather than traditional pigments. For example, his series of screenprints might employ vibrant reds, blues, or yellows applied in uniform layers, eliminating any trace of the artist's hand. This approach reflects his belief in objectivity and mass production, yet each print retains a tactile quality through careful paper selection and printing methods.
Influenced by movements like Constructivism and the Bauhaus, Judd's work emphasizes simplicity without being simplistic. His prints demand attention to proportion, edge, and the interaction between positive and negative space, making them ideal for modern interiors that value clean lines and thoughtful composition.

How to Authenticate and Purchase Judd Prints
When searching for Donald Judd prints for sale, authenticity is paramount. Look for documentation such as certificates of authenticity, provenance records, and edition details (e.g., 15/100). Reputable galleries and auction houses often provide these, referencing catalogs raisonnés or the artist's estate. Condition is also critical; inspect for fading, tears, or discoloration, as Judd's use of industrial colors can be sensitive to light.

What techniques did Donald Judd use in his prints?
Judd primarily employed screenprinting and lithography, favoring these methods for their ability to produce flat, uniform colors and precise geometric shapes. He often used industrial materials, reflecting his interest in mass production and objectivity.
